The Influence of Translation Software on Digital Communication


Digital communication has redefined how people share information. Emails, instant messages, and online platforms allow ideas to travel instantly. However, language differences can slow or distort these exchanges. Translation software plays a critical role in ensuring that digital communication remains inclusive and effective.

Modern translation tools rely on large datasets and intelligent algorithms to produce accurate results. By studying how languages are used in real-world contexts, these systems learn to recognize patterns and predict appropriate translations. This continuous learning process helps improve quality over time.

One of the most significant benefits of translation software is speed. Users no longer need to wait for manual translations to understand foreign-language content. This immediacy is especially valuable in fast-moving environments such as customer support, international collaboration, and online learning.

Educational platforms have embraced translation technology to reach wider audiences. Students from different regions can access the same materials, regardless of language barriers. This fosters knowledge sharing and encourages global perspectives in academic discussions.

In professional settings, translation software supports teamwork across borders. Multinational organizations rely on it to share internal documents, conduct meetings, and coordinate projects. Clear communication helps reduce errors and strengthens collaboration among diverse teams.

Despite its usefulness, translation software must be used responsibly. Overreliance on automated tools can lead to misunderstandings if users assume perfect accuracy. Awareness of limitations encourages users to verify critical information and apply human judgment when necessary.

Future developments point toward deeper personalization. Translation tools may soon adapt to individual writing styles, professional terminology, or preferred expressions. Such customization will make translations more relevant and user-friendly.

As digital communication continues to expand, translation software remains a foundational element. It ensures that language differences do not become obstacles but instead serve as opportunities for broader connection and understanding in a global digital society.
